profile · synthesized from sources

Private foundation based in New York that makes unrestricted grants to nonprofit organizations, primarily in the healthcare and education sectors. In 2025, it distributed funds to institutions including cancer centers, children's hospitals, senior living services, and schools. The foundation does not appear to operate direct programs, focusing instead on philanthropic support to other nonprofits.
